The Professional Insurance Agents of New York announced they will hold their annual Metropolitan Regional Awareness Program Jan. 28 at the New York Marriott in Brooklyn, N.Y.
PIANY said the event will offer two continuing education classes hosted by Ivan Cohen. One class will cover New York and New Jersey multistate workers' compensation exposure issues, and the other will cover instruction on errors and omissions loss prevention issues for insurance agents and brokers.
The meeting will also feature a trade show and the New York Young Insurance Professionals networking reception.
This is the first of three regional programs for 2010. The other two are scheduled for Long Island in April and the Hudson Valley in the fall.
